aboutsummaryrefslogtreecommitdiffhomepage
path: root/Eigen/src/Core
diff options
context:
space:
mode:
authorGravatar Kenneth Frank Riddile <kfriddile@yahoo.com>2009-04-03 20:19:07 +0000
committerGravatar Kenneth Frank Riddile <kfriddile@yahoo.com>2009-04-03 20:19:07 +0000
commit9a8096dd1daede80efad30680948b139e307f25e (patch)
tree4066d627f5d10e8da2d7207ec8fa7007dbc150a9 /Eigen/src/Core
parentff3a3209ca51e03d9471524dd06e13356c2d31bd (diff)
* fixed truncation warnings caused by MatrixBase::CoeffReturnType under MSVC
Diffstat (limited to 'Eigen/src/Core')
-rw-r--r--Eigen/src/Core/MatrixBase.h2
1 files changed, 1 insertions, 1 deletions
diff --git a/Eigen/src/Core/MatrixBase.h b/Eigen/src/Core/MatrixBase.h
index 2d6b3d85b..fad1e305d 100644
--- a/Eigen/src/Core/MatrixBase.h
+++ b/Eigen/src/Core/MatrixBase.h
@@ -201,7 +201,7 @@ template<typename Derived> class MatrixBase
/** \internal the return type of coeff()
*/
- typedef typename ei_meta_if<int(Flags)&DirectAccessBit, const Scalar&, Scalar>::ret CoeffReturnType;
+ typedef typename ei_meta_if<bool(int(Flags)&DirectAccessBit), const Scalar&, Scalar>::ret CoeffReturnType;
/** \internal Represents a matrix with all coefficients equal to one another*/
typedef CwiseNullaryOp<ei_scalar_constant_op<Scalar>,Derived> ConstantReturnType;